The signal to the Evap control solenoid is...

The signal to the Evap control solenoid is hijacked and the signal sent to the boost control solenoid. Simple splice of the two evap solenoid wires redirected to the boost solenoid.

Warning and Start boost are PSI specific....

Warning and Start boost are PSI specific. Limiter, Set boost and Gain settings are all percentage. My tuner looked at the OLED Profec like it was a piece of Alien Technology.
